Stated Role The Armée de Terre contributes the bulk of the forces of the FARDC. It is made of infantry units spread across the 10 military regions of the country.<P>The reconstruction of the FARDC following the peace process of the end of the Second Congo War in July 2003 has led to the incorporation into the Land Forces of soldiers issued of the rebel factions that signed the peace agreement.
